KNOX, Pa. (EYT) — A Knox man facing drug possession and child endangerment charges after borough police discovered methamphetamine, marijuana, and related items in his house, is due in court next week.

Cameron Allen Goodman, 20, of Knox, is scheduled to appear at a preliminary hearing before Magisterial District Judge Amy Long Turk at 10:30 a.m. on February 19.

According to court documents, on Tuesday, January 22, the Knox Borough Police Department filed the following charges against Goodman at Judge Long Turk’s office:

– Endangering Welfare of Children — Parent/Guardian/Other Commits Offense, Misdemeanor 1
– Make Repairs/Sell/Etc Offense Weapons, Misdemeanor 1
– Intentional Possession Controlled Substance By Person Not Registered, Misdemeanor (three counts)
– Use/Possession Of Drug Paraphernalia (27 counts)
– Use Information To Own Advantage, Misdemeanor
– Failure To Notify Change In Address

The charges were filed following a visit to Goodman’s home on White Avenue on January 8.

According to a criminal complaint, around 3:41 p.m. on January 8, Patrolman Bowen went to a residence on White Avenue regarding another investigation that he was conducting. While in the residence, he observed a strong odor of marijuana.

The complaint states that after receiving a consent search, Patrolman Bowen “found the following items in a bedroom belonging to Cameron Goodman:”

These items were in reach of a known, five-year-old male at the residence.

Goodman remains free on $10,000.00 unsecured bail.
